Recognizing Rheumatoid Arthritis and Its Impact



When you're identified with rheumatoid joint inflammation (RA), it's vital to understand exactly how the condition affects your body and daily life. RA is an autoimmune disorder where your immune system erroneously strikes the lining of your joints, causing inflammation, discomfort, and stiffness.

This can result in exhaustion and restrict your movement, making everyday tasks testing. You might discover flare-ups that vary in intensity, impacting your mood and total wellness.

Introduction of Treatment Choices



Taking care of rheumatoid joint inflammation calls for a detailed method to therapy that deals with both signs and the underlying swelling. Your options typically include medicines, lifestyle adjustments, and physical treatment.

Disease-modifying antirheumatic medicines (DMARDs) are commonly first-line treatments, aiding to reduce disease progression. N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ory medicines (NSAIDs) can relieve discomfort and swelling. Corticosteroids may be prescribed for short-term sign relief.

Along with medications, integrating routine workout, a balanced diet plan, and anxiety monitoring techniques can boost your total well-being.

You might also explore different therapies like acupuncture or massage therapy, which some locate advantageous.
